Transaction 7a3f89af5421a63a6ea91f29cd051405052c754c9fd5b5fee15b4bf26d9f6a68

1 Input
2 Outputs
  • 7a3f89af5421a63a6ea91f29cd051405052c754c9fd5b5fee15b4bf26d9f6a68:0
  • value  110854843
    address  3JHD9RwBk9A6ANPZKcCbzMRC2RCYgvNWvE
  • 7a3f89af5421a63a6ea91f29cd051405052c754c9fd5b5fee15b4bf26d9f6a68:1
  • value  1386028
    address  3218VAcckdWqdWfH393uctxw2w5uN7iBEJ